Rohālti
Rohālti is a hamlet in Junga, Shimla district, Himachal Pradesh and has an elevation of 2,222 metres. Rohālti is situated nearby to the hamlet Nehara, as well as near Pāti.Places in the Area
Nearby places include Kufri and Chail.
Kufri

Kufri is a resort hill station in the district of Shimla, India. It is located 12 km from the state capital Shimla on the National Highway 5. On the Kufri Avenue, the main thoroughfare, boutiques and restaurants mix with Indian-style hotels and souvenir shops are to look for during a visit.
Chail

Chail is a village and hill station in Southern Himachal Pradesh, India at a height of 2,250 m above sea level. It was built as a Summer Capital by Maharaja of Patiala Bhupinder Singh when he was exiled from Shimla by British Lord Kitchener.
